📸 Nationals Headshots Day = Pure Joy

Our Nationals Titleholder Headshot Day is truly something special. Once the competition has wrapped, we set aside time to capture the official portraits of each titleholder in their brand-new crown and sash. These photos are used in social media campaigns, program books, and pageant promotions throughout the year. We also work together to create beautiful national pageant headshots, which is SO important because it is any pageant judge’s first impression of the contestant, so we want them to absolutely sparkle!
